Analysis

The most recent figure for personal remittances, paid in Africa Eastern and Southern is 3.03 billion current US$, measured in 2025.

That represents a change of down 48.1% on the previous year and down 40.5% over ten years.

Over the whole period, personal remittances, paid in Africa Eastern and Southern peaked at 6.67 billion current US$ in 2022 and was at its lowest, 236.60 million current US$, in 1970.

Africa Eastern and Southern ranks 35th of 45 groups on this measure, in the bottom quarter.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Personal remittances comprise personal transfers and compensation of employees. Personal transfers consist of all current transfers in cash or in kind made or received by resident households to or from nonresident households. Personal transfers thus include all current transfers between resident and nonresident individuals. Compensation of employees refers to the income of border, seasonal, and other short-term workers who are employed in an economy where they are not resident and of residents employed by nonresident entities. Data are the sum of two items defined in the sixth edition of the IMF's Balance of Payments Manual: personal transfers and compensation of employees. Data are in current U.S. dollars.
